Wagstaff is a little bit ...  arrogance of modern poeple's high self-confidence in science, believing that he can recognize and domesticate everything. This kind of thinking is exactly what is denied in Cthulhu culture, and the backstory of don't starve is deeply influenced by Cthulhu culture, so I guess it's hard for wagstaff to succeed. But he is also the epitome of the tenacity of human beings in the face of all kinds of supernatural beings on the crazy world of the constant, so I also don't want him to lose too much in the showdown with shadow creatures or other magical monsters.
From wagstaff's dialogue in DS and his performance in DST, it can be seen that he is too focused on imagining the future and technological progress, but does not care about those who really need help at the moment, which the survivors. This kind of lofty ambition is a common problem of many people who think that they are working for the welfare of all mankind but lack practicality. If wagstaff does end up getting a failure, that would be a good reason.
